Hansons Swan Valley, Perth

Hansons Swan Valley is a ten room boutique hotel set on 25 acres overlooking the banks of the Swan River in Perth’s Wine Country – The Swan Valley. Hansons Swan Valley offers luxurious, cosmopolitan amenities and service in a peaceful, rural setting. It is a small, private retreat where people are assured of knowledgeable service with privacy and discretion. Yet for all its rural location, Hansons Swan Valley is just 25 minutes from the Perth central business district.

Guests may choose from a total of ten rooms. Six rooms are offered with spas and king size beds and four with queen size beds and ensuites. Each room also offers television/video, a fully stocked minibar, remote controlled reverse cycle airconditioning, balcony or small courtyard, thick white bathrobes and direct dial phones. A pool and conference facilities are also available. The stylish and contemporary design and decor of Hansons Swan Valley sets it apart.

Another outstanding feature of Hansons Swan Valley is the cuisine. A la carte breakfast, lunch and evening meals are offered – seasonally inspired regional cuisine of the very highest standard using fresh local produce. This superb cuisine is exclusively matched with wines that are grown and made in the Swan Valley.

The Swan Valley is a region of gourmet food producers, fine restaurants and contains some of Western Australia’s best galleries, wineries and restaurants.

Hansons Swan Valley is a luxurious boutique hotel which makes the perfect base from which to explore the Swan Valley or as a peaceful base from which to day trip into Perth.
